While the margin was a desperate nose, the filly nicknamed the \u201cGrizzly Bear\u201d came out on the winning end of a dramatic stretch duel with Grade 1-winner Dorth Vader in front of a raucous Saratoga Race Course grandstand.<\/p>\n<p>In victory, the 4-year-old daughter of Fast Anna was awarded a \u201cWin and You\u2019re In\u201d berth into the Grade 1 Breeders\u2019 Cup Distaff, a race she won last November to cap her tremendous sophomore season that featured a Grade 1 Kentucky Oaks coup and two Grade 1 scores at the Spa in the DK Horse Acorn and Coaching Club American Oaks ahead of a head second to Fierceness in the Grade 1 DraftKings Travers and another top-level victory in Parx Racing\u2019s Cotillion.<\/p>\n<p>McPeek was quick to give credit to the George Weaver-trained Dorth Vader for her admirable effort.<\/p>\n<p>&#8220;George did a great job, that filly ran super and seems to be improving,\u201d McPeek said. \u201cShe&#8217;s a tough customer.&#8221;\u00a0<\/p>\n<p>The Personal Ensign was Thorpedo Anna\u2019s fourth win from five starts this year, and came with a stalking trip engineered by regular pilot Brian Hernandez, Jr., who held the dark bay in third through the early stages after breaking from the outermost post 7 as dual Grade 1-winner Randomized zipped up the rail to mark an opening quarter-mile in 23.24 seconds under pressure from 50-1 longshot Bernietakescharge.<\/p>\n<p>A tightly-bunched group followed the top pair with Thorpedo Anna racing to the outside of last-out Grade 2 Shuvee-winner Leslie\u2019s Rose just ahead of Dorth Vader and a sizable gap back to Dazzling Move and the late-running Raging Sea heading onto the backstretch. Hernandez, Jr. kept the pacesetters within his grasp as the half-mile elapsed in 47.11 and coaxed Thorpedo Anna into contention to make it three across the track approaching the turn.<\/p>\n<p>McPeek said he was comfortable with Thorpedo Anna being wide down the backstretch.<\/p>\n<p>&#8220;I think he needed to stay out of trouble,\u201d McPeek explained. \u201cI gave him [Hernandez, Jr.] instructions, &#8216;don&#8217;t worry about the loss of ground, you are going to lose a little ground, but I&#8217;d rather you do that than get her in behind horses and give her a chance to get stopped and blocked.'&#8221;\u00a0<\/p>\n<p>Bernietakescharge threw in the towel and Randomized came under a ride as Thorpedo Anna swept to the lead with ease in the turn, leaving the closers to give chase through three-quarters in 1:11.27 with Dorth Vader the main danger on the outside and Leslie\u2019s Rose creeping closer.<\/p>\n<p>Thorpedo Anna held a half-length lead over Grade 1 Odgen Phipps presented by Ford-winner Dorth Vader at the stretch call, but her margin was threatened with every stride as the Weaver trainee did everything in her power to pass the Champion through one mile in 1:36.42. In a spectacular stretch drive, Thorpedo Anna dug in with great fortitude to will herself to the wire a nose better than her game challenger, and completed the course in 1:49.18 over the fast footing.<\/p>\n<p>Hernandez, Jr., aboard for each of Thorpedo Anna\u2019s 15 starts, said Saturday\u2019s result proves Thorpedo Anna is still among the best horses in North America.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cI don\u2019t know if she was all out, but it\u2019s just the fact of in these Grade 1 races these horses they keep taking shots at you and you gotta respect them all and today\u2019s another version of that,\u201d Hernandez, Jr. said. \u201cYou know, our filly is Horse of the Year, and she showed why she deservingly should be.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cShe put herself in a great spot. She showed what a true Champion she was,\u201d Hernandez, Jr. continued. \u201cYou know, all I had to do was kind of stay out of her way. She decided to make her run. I just let her do her thing. She showed the heart of a Champion down the lane to hold Dorth Vader off and be able to get her nose down at the wire. A really special win.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>It was a further 9 3\/4 lengths back to Leslie\u2019s Rose in third with last year\u2019s Ensign-winner Raging Sea completing the superfecta. Dazzling Move, Randomized and Bernietakescharge completed the order of finish.<\/p>\n<p>McPeek praised his prized filly for her grit, while also tipping his cap to Dorth Vader, who entered from a pace-pressing fourth in the Grade 3 Molly Pitcher on July 19 at Monmouth Park.<\/p>\n<p>&#8220;She just shows how brave she is,\u201d McPeek said. \u201cI thought George Weaver&#8217;s filly ran fantastic, she ran really the race of her life, but my filly, maybe, Brian seemed to think she got quite tired out of the race, too. I think that will actually lead her into the next one in even better shape. That wasn&#8217;t as easy as we&#8217;d want it to be, but she is a Champion. That is why she wins.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>Weaver was equally complimentary of the dual Champion, and said he welcomes a rematch in this year\u2019s Grade 1 Breeders\u2019 Cup Distaff on November 1 at Del Mar.\u00a0<\/p>\n<p>\u201cI actually thought she got her nose down and won,\u201d Weaver said of Dorth Vader. \u201cWhen they threw the photo up and I watched the replay, I though, \u2018oh no, we got nosed.\u2019 It was a great race. Unfortunately, I\u2019m on the losing end of the photo but all in all, I think Dorth Vader validated her status in this division and we\u2019re looking forward to going to the Breeders\u2019 Cup.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>Thorpedo Anna has raced and won at six different racetracks, and could visit a new one next as McPeek said the Grade 3 Delaware Handicap on September 28 is a potential target moving forward. Another possible spot is the Grade 1 Spinster on October 5 at Keeneland, the track she broke her maiden over on debut in October 2023.<\/p>\n<p>&#8220;I&#8217;m going to cross-nominate to the Spinster and the Delaware Handicap,\u201d McPeek said. \u201cThere&#8217;s a chance we could go to Delaware with her, we are going to talk about it, and there&#8217;s a chance we could go to Keeneland.&#8221;\u00a0<\/p>\n<p>Campaigned by Hill \u2018n\u2019 Dale Equine Holdings, Magdalena Racing, Mark Edwards and breeder Judy Hicks, Thorpedo Anna adds to wins earlier this year in the Grade 2 Azeri and Grade 1 Apple Blossom Handicap at Oaklawn Park, and entered from a win in the Grade 2 Fleur de Lis on June 28 at Churchill Downs. She banked $275,000 in victory while improving her lifetime record to 15-12-2-0 and returning $3.50 on a $2 win ticket.<\/p>\n<p>Out of the unraced Uncle Mo mare Sataves, Thorpedo Anna is a half-sister to multiple graded stakes-placed McAfee, a son of Cloud Computing who runs in the Grade 1 DraftKings Travers for trainer Rick Dutrow, Jr. later on Saturday\u2019s card.<\/p>\n<p>Live racing resumes Sunday at Saratoga with a 10-race card featuring the $150,000 West Point presented by Rood and Riddle Equine Hospital in Race 8.
